In this episode, we talk to Elizabeth Brown, Founder of COCOON South Africa, a sustainable local brand that uses Recycled Plastic and Upcycled Cotton. Libby grew up between the Uk and SA. Libby started her career as an educator and moved on to start her first business in stationery before moving on to what is now known as COCOON South Africa an award-winning brand in South Africa designing and producing sustainable bags and homeware items. In her spare time, she enjoys swimming and walking. She is married to her childhood sweetheart of 23 years and they have 3 children.
In this conversation, she talks to us about the Journey of managing a sustainable brand and what it takes to produce locally made items.

Period Poverty affects over 7 million women in South African and millions more across the globe. It is a lack of access to sanitary products and forces many to use unhygienic alternatives in place of pads, tampons, and the like.
Our guest today talks about her journey in starting her NPO PadsRus in a bid to help end Period Poverty in local communities. Mangkgateng Seshibe is an economics graduate, a (YALI) young African leaders initiative alumni, founder and chairperson of Padsrus, and an entrepreneur. She founded Eden events in 2018 an events coordination Business that added a gifting company in 2020 called EdenGiftings. In 2019 she was chosen by inside education as one of the top 100 shining stars in South Africa.
Mangkgateng is passionate about women's empowerment and is continuing to work hard to grow her business and NPO.
Her NPO PadsRus has been Running for the past 7 years. Not only do they donate pads and toiletries to underprivileged women but they help young women achieve their goals and empower them to reach their full potential.

The Business of Ethical and Sustainable Fashion can be very complex. My guest today is an Ethical Fashion Brand founder and she talks to us about her journey of starting Mayamiko.
Paola is an impact entrepreneur and founder of award-winning, responsible fashion label Mayamiko, which counts Meghan Markle amongst its fans. Paola is also the founder of women empowerment charity Mayamiko Trust, working in Malawi delivering economic and social empowerment programmes with women and for women. Malawi is where much of the production for Mayamiko takes place, creating a sustainable economic model for local partners.
Paola’s background combines digital innovation and marketing, linguistics and communication, and international development.
Paola has recently created Madeby_, a technology solution developed based on her fashion industry experience, aimed at increasing trust and transparency, and combatting greenwashing.
Born and raised in Milan, Italy, with family in Australia and Sri Lanka, over the last 20 years Paola has lived in Germany, the UK and Malawi, making her a true world citizen… still, she can’t start the day without a good cappuccino!

The basic foundation of a society emanates from its education. Sipumelele Lucwaba is the Lead: Strategy and Grant Management at Funda Wande and she talks us through the current state of Education in South Africa and some of the efforts being made by Organisations like Funda Wande to focus on the foundation phase of Education as learners move through the system. Quality Education is a goal highlighted across different developmental frameworks such as the Sustainable Development Goals 2030, National Development Plan in South Africa, and of course the African Union Agenda 2063.
Listen to this insightful conversation on where we truly are post Covid-19 and what some of the efforts and goals are being made in this space.
